What Custom Orthotics Really Address
Custom orthotics aren’t just for arch support. They’re calibrated to correct how force travels through your feet during motion. Subtle misalignments in the way you walk or stand may not seem urgent, but over time they influence joint wear, muscle fatigue, and even nerve compression. These inserts help redistribute pressure, improve alignment, and stabilise your foundation with every step.
Symptoms Often Mislabelled as ‘Normal’
A surprising number of patients who benefit from orthotics have never considered their feet the source of the problem. Recurring hip tightness, lower back tension, or one-sided knee pain is frequently linked to asymmetrical foot mechanics. A comprehensive gait analysis often reveals that what feels like a muscle issue is actually rooted in how the body compensates for misaligned foot posture.

The Precision Behind the Prescription
High-quality orthotics begin with more than just a foam impression. Specialists use 3D scanning, pressure-mapping technology, and full gait assessments to understand how your feet behave dynamically. This data allows them to create a device tailored to your body, lifestyle, and footwear. Unlike over-the-counter insoles, the result isn’t just supportive—it’s corrective.
